Subtract 63/16 from 40/15
1st number: 2 10/15, 2nd number: 3 15/16
40/15 - 63/16 is -61/48.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 15 and 16 is 240
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 240 - For the 1st fraction, since 15 × 16 = 240,
40/15 = 40 × 16/15 × 16 = 640/240 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 16 × 15 = 240,
63/16 = 63 × 15/16 × 15 = 945/240 - Subtract the two like fractions:
640/240 - 945/240 = 640 - 945/240 = -305/240 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is -61/48
